CVE-2005-4051 describes a vulnerability in e107 version 0.6174 that allows remote attackers to manipulate download ratings. By repeatedly sending requests to rate.php, an attacker can vote multiple times for a single download, potentially skewing statistics. This vulnerability has a CVSS score of 5.0, indicating a medium severity, and is easily exploitable over the network with low attack complexity, resulting in a partial integrity impact.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ion surrounding this decade-old flaw.
